## Zero-Downtime Migrations

Plugin authors targeting the Varnholt schema layer must assume reads and writes overlap every migration phase. Dual-write mode stays active until backfill verification completes, so plugins should tolerate both column layouts. Backfill batch sizes and verification intervals are tunable per deployment; the Varnholt defaults below suit most workloads. The constants currently shipped in the reference config are as follows.

tuning table, yajog-yahof:
BUDGETS = {
    "lamvan": 303,
    "wenox": 460,
    "fenvan": 525,
}

Visitor policy — temporary site. While Marleigh Court is being renovated, all staff of Fenwick & Dray operate from the temporary site at Alderman's Wharf. Visitors must be pre-booked and escorted at all times; the wharf building has no staffed reception, so hosts should meet guests at the riverside entrance. The entrance is kept locked outside of deliveries. Staff can let themselves and their escorted visitors in using the code below.

turnstile pass: bdg-TXR-4

# Hey on-call — quick context before you touch anything. Payment retries in
# Tollgate dedupe on idempotency keys, and those keys are derived from a
# server-side secret. If that secret changes mid-incident, in-flight retries
# can double-charge, so only rotate it when the retry queue is drained.
# The current derivation secret sits on the line below.

sealed setting: VAULT_KEY20=c8ea1e419912889df6b4